Output 7698276c0b86e22214d6a7e0fa27e5b7574264166a22580f5a0a9b516bc7afee:2

value
2687378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a2f88cccc3692d6ad5529e600b5d11bfa94bf1 OP_EQUAL
address
3MXmnb2aCT2sodYaAr3kWKdrmpWV7wqAUr
transaction
7698276c0b86e22214d6a7e0fa27e5b7574264166a22580f5a0a9b516bc7afee
spent
true